Understanding Subscription Options
Before you decide whether to hit pause or go all the way to cancel town, let's break down what these options mean for your beauty subscription box. Subscriptions today are super flexible, which is great news if you're feeling overwhelmed with products.
With a pause option, many companies allow you to temporarily halt deliveries. You won't be billed during this time, and you won’t receive any new boxes. It’s like pressing the snooze button on your beauty haul—it holds your spot and keeps your account with them active.
Canceling, on the other hand, ends the relationship. Once you cancel, you stop all deliveries and forfeit any perks that might have been stacking up in your account. If you decide to return, you might have to sign up fresh with a new subscription.
Option | Billing | Deliveries | Account Status |
---|---|---|---|
Pause | No billing | No deliveries | Active |
Cancel | No billing | No deliveries | Inactive |

Benefits of Pausing
So, why might pausing your beauty subscription box be a good idea? Well, let's break it down. Pausing offers a flexible way to take a breather without going full cold turkey on your beauty treats. This option gives you room to breathe and possibly fall in love with some of your stash all over again.
One major perk is managing your stash. If your bathroom shelves are about to spill over, a pause is like pressing the reset button. You get some time to try out those products, figure out what you love, and what might just not be your jam.
Money-wise, a pause can help keep you financially sane. It lets you hold onto your subscription perks without opening your wallet every month. Some boxes even let you skip a month, so you’re only buying when you’re really craving something new.
Then there's the loyalty perks. Many subscriptions offer incentives for long-time members. Pausing rather than cancelling helps you maintain those perks, including any accumulated points or discounts.
Plus, pausing can be super easy. Most companies have streamlined the process. Generally, all it takes is logging into your account, selecting the pause option, and you’re done!
Just remember, be sure to check the company's rules. Some might have a limit on how long you can pause. It's always good to know the details to avoid any surprises!

Reasons to Cancel
Sometimes, it's just time to say goodbye to your beauty subscription box. And that's perfectly fine! There are a bunch of reasons why canceling might be the best move for you. Let’s break down the common triggers that push people to go from pause to cancel.
Financial Tight Spots: We all know money doesn’t grow on trees, and those monthly subscriptions can add up. Canceling your subscription is a quick way to cut down on expenses. It’s like choosing between pizza night and that serum you’ve never heard of.
Product Overload: Do you have more beauty products than you know what to do with? We’ve all been there. When your cabinets start looking like a mini Sephora, it can be time to rethink why you’re still subscribing. Canceling gives you a chance to use what you have without piling on more.
Lifestyle Changes: Life happens—whether it's a new job, a move, or just a shift in priorities. Maybe you've started embracing a minimalist lifestyle, or you're traveling more and have no time to experiment with new products. Canceling your beauty box can align with your new habits and goals.
Dissatisfaction with Products: Sometimes, the excitement of new goodies turns into disappointment. If you frequently find that the products aren’t suitable for your skin type or preferences, canceling might be the answer. After all, what’s the point if it’s not making you feel fabulous?
Service Issues: Yes, even the best services can have hiccups. Maybe you've been on hold forever just to resolve a simple issue or your box comes late, missing items. Consistent poor service can make you wonder if it’s worth the hassle.
